Jazz with storytelling singing.

Singer and songwriter Dina Grundberg has established herself as a strong voice on the Swedish jazz scene. She tours extensively throughout Sweden and has also arranged music for big bands and performed her songs with the Bohuslän Big Band. This spring she released the follow-up Nasty oversensitive, which was praised by critics. P2 described her songs as "riveting and self-examining jazz songs".

The music flows between heavy tango, jazz waltz and durable swing. In the lyrics, everyday life takes its place, throwing itself on the floor and screaming. Dina Grundberg is happy! And angry. Worried about her finances. Is she just human, or hideously oversensitive? Now she invites you to a concert in a trio setting where the audience can take part in her own musical landscape, between revue and jazz poetry.

Other qualifications:

Dina writes her own music and has been compared to both international jazz giants and Swedish profiles such as Barbro Hörberg, Lisa Ekdahl and Hasse & Tage. She arranges her music for different settings and has performed her own big band arrangements with Bohuslän Big Band. Her jazz songs for children's choir are published in the booklet Flyga och falla (musikskolan.se), which was presented at the Gothenburg Book Fair in 2024.

Her debut album "Jag ljuger mest om allt" (Kakafon Records, 2022) was critically acclaimed, and Orkesterjournalen listed the album as one of the year's top releases. With a playful brass section and a swinging accompaniment, her story-telling vocals are enhanced, where everyday images are in focus.

In February 2025, the sequel "Otäckt överkensyl" was released, in which Grundberg further develops his storytelling and allows everyday reflections to take place.
